2. Ignoring the "Rust Belt Tax" Until Your Brakes Squeal

If you live in Wisconsin, you pay the "Rust Belt Tax." That’s the layer of salt, slush, and grime that eats your undercarriage for breakfast.

Most people wait until they hear that awful screeeech at a stoplight on Oneida Street before they think about their brakes. By then, the salt has usually pitted your rotors so bad they look like the surface of the moon. Add in Fox River slush and all the junk kicked up around the Leo Frigo bridge, and yah hey, your brake hardware doesn’t stand much of a chance if you ignore it.

6. Waiting for the "Big Freeze" to Check Your Battery

In Wisconsin, a weak battery is basically a ticking time bomb. It might start fine when it's 40 degrees, but once the cold really settles in and that Fox River slush is freezing up on everything, that battery is going to give up the ghost right when you’re late for the game at Lambeau.

7. Neglecting Your Fluids (The Lifeblood of a Rust Belt Car)

It’s not just about the oil. Your brake fluid, transmission fluid, and coolant all take a beating in our extreme temperatures. If your coolant isn't at the right mixture, it can actually freeze and crack your engine block.
